JUDGING CRITERIA: Prezi’s professional design team (“Judges”) shall judge each Qualified Submission on a 100-point scale: 

  1. Creativity and Uniqueness (30 points) 

  2. Effective use of Prezi tools (50 points) 

  3. Overall visual appeal and proper spelling and grammar (20 points)

In addition to the foregoing, Judges will be applying specific elements to the individual categories as outlined below. In the event of a tie, tied entries will be rescored giving double weight to overall visual appeal and proper spelling and grammar.

 

PREZI EXPERTS HEAT
 

- Best Overall Prezi Presentation: The Contestant with the highest overall score, as outlined in the Judging Criteria, will also effectively use the visual metaphor / design, will not overuse specific tools, such as the zoom function, and has compelling content in the presentation.  Submission must include a minimum of three path points and six pieces of content (text, images, and/or videos).
 

- Best Business Prezi Presentation: The best business Submission submitted by a Prezi Expert must be a presentation for an existing organization or company.
 

Most Innovative Use of Prezi for a Presentation: The Prezi Expert Submission that uses Prezi in the most unique way, that also meets the judging criteria.

 

PREZI MEMBERS HEAT

 

- Best Overall Design Presentation: The Contestant with the highest overall score, as outlined in the Judging Criteria, will also effectively use the visual metaphor / design, will not overuse specific tools, such as the zoom function, and has compelling content in the presentation.  Submission must include a minimum of three path points and six pieces of content (text, images, and/or videos).
 

- Best Storytelling Presentation: The Submission that tells the most compelling story from beginning to end, regardless of subject matter.
 

- Best Use of Animations Presentation: The Submission that features the most effective and creative use of the zoom feature and/or the custom starting point feature. 

 

- Best Educational Presentation: The Submission that most effectively gives an educational overview about a topic or an educational or nonprofit organization. 

 

- Best Business Presentation: The best business Submission must be a presentation for an existing organization or company. 

 

ALL MEMBER HEAT
 

Video Categories:

- Prezi Video: Best Overall: The Video that best captures the benefits of Prezi Video, including interacting with content, use of animations, and overall storytelling.
 

- Prezi Video: Staff Favorite: The Staff Favorite Video will be selected by the Judges based on criteria including design, visual metaphor, use of animations, and effective use of story.
